WebJun 10, 2024 · Join Date: Jan 2012. Location: Cincinnati. Posts: 19,927. You can add seat belts anywhere you'd like. Problem is, they won't be considered legitimate by Federal authorities. If you anchor them as securely as possible, they may hold a person in the event of an accident, but they won't be 'official.'. The use of car seats and seat belts is not federally regulated, and laws vary by state. Some states require the use of car seats -- and that all RVs be outfitted with seating that accommodates them. Other states mandate that only some seat belts be available.

WebThere are no federal laws regarding seat belt usage in motor vehicles, however, “All States require, at a minimum, that all children 3 or younger, weighing less than 40 lbs., or less than 40 inches tall, be secured in child restraint systems while traveling in motor vehicles.”NHTSA Summary. Beyond that, every state has different laws for adult and child passengers.
